更新记录

1.0.1(2023-04-06)

增加文档说明

1.0.0(2023-04-06)

添加闹铃


平台兼容性

Vue2 Vue3
App 快应用 微信小程序 支付宝小程序 百度小程序 字节小程序 QQ小程序
HBuilderX 3.6.8,Android:支持,iOS:不支持 × × × × × ×
钉钉小程序 快手小程序 飞书小程序 京东小程序
× × × ×
H5-Safari Android Browser 微信浏览器(Android) QQ浏览器(Android) Chrome IE Edge Firefox PC-Safari
× × × × × × × × ×

laoqianjunzi-calender

uni-app 开发 android (ios暂定)平台设置日历提醒

使用介绍

  1. 使用 HBuilderx 导入插件,在相关文件中引入
<template>
    <view>
        <view class="btn" @click="doUtsAdd">
            Uts添加闹铃
        </view>
        <view class="btn" @click="doUtsDelete">
            Uts删除闹铃
        </view>
    </view>
</template>

<script>
    const app = getApp();

    import {
        alarmAdd,
        alarmDelete
    } from "@/uni_modules/laoqianjunzi-alarm"; 

    export default {
        data() {
            return {

            };
        },

        methods: {
            doUtsAdd() {

                let params = {
                    name : 'dida', //闹铃名称
                    weekday : '123456', //重复星期
                    hour : 10, //闹铃时
                    minutes : 14, //分钟
                    ringtone : 'https://jubaomusics.oss-cn-beijing.aliyuncs.com/%E4%B8%89%E5%8F%AA%E5%B0%8F%E7%8C%AA/%E4%B8%89%E5%8F%AA%E5%B0%8F%E7%8C%AA.mp3', //铃声
                }
                alarmAdd({
                    params:params,
                    success: (res) => {
                        console.log('success', res)

                    },
                    fail: (res) => {
                        console.log('fail', res)
                    },
                    complete: () => {
                        console.log('complete')
                    },
                })
            },
            doUtsDelete() {
                alarmDelete()
            },

        },
    };
</script>
  1. 方法说明
参数 类型 必填 说明
params Object 调用参数
success Function 接口调用成功的回调函数
fail Function 接口调用失败的回调函数
complete Function 接口调用结束的回调函数(调用成功、失败都会执行)
  1. alarmAdd 参数一对象值说明
字段 描述 默认值 是否必填
name 闹铃名称
weekday 重复星期
hour 小时
minutes 分钟
ringtone 铃声
  1. 在 manifest.json 文件中找到对应权限并勾选:
<uses-permission android:name="com.android.alarm.permission.SET_ALARM" />
<uses-permission android:name="android.permission.SET_ALARM" />

鼓励作者

如果你觉得该插件方便实用,并且解决了你的问题。可以小小的赞赏一下作者,你的鼓励会更有动力,加油,一起努力。

隐私、权限声明

1. 本插件需要申请的系统权限列表:

com.android.alarm.permission.SET_ALARM android.permission.SET_ALARM

2. 本插件采集的数据、发送的服务器地址、以及数据用途说明:

插件不采集任何数据

3. 本插件是否包含广告,如包含需详细说明广告表达方式、展示频率:

许可协议

MIT协议

使用中有什么不明白的地方,就向插件作者提问吧~ 我要提问